Our Flight Training program consists of 4 essential parts: Ground School, Flight Lesson, Briefings, and Homework. Each of these parts is designed to help students to expand their knowledge and hone their skills while becoming sky-bound.

Ground School

Having good ground knowledge is as important as knowing how to fly a plane. At VT AAA, our knowledgeable and experienced instructors will provide you with the necessary tools and experience you need to become a skilled aviator.

After you have equipped yourself with the information and theories that you’ve learned at the ground school, the next step will be to sit for a ‘Written’ FAA exam. This exam will be a computerized test and will include multiple-choice questions (MCQ). Students will have to score at least 70 or better marks to pass the test.

TIPS FOR SUCCESS

Read

Students often do not realize that flight training also includes reading a textbook and other materials to understand the fundamentals of aviation. Read up on the lessons that you will be covering in the next ground lesson. Memorize key information. Write down any questions and ask your instructor.

CHAIR FLYING

Practice this after a flight lesson – sit on a chair, close your eyes, and visualize your flight lesson. Flip switches, read the flight panel and perform maneuvers while sitting in your living room or bedroom. Building up your muscle memory and your decision-making process by practicing flying at home will help you master your flight lessons faster.
